Output e3831d13e70cfbb14da69027655e3787d67d53b87566a58460b7ea6704458afa:10

value
55990000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2008882440255251a0484933e2c342b3e0684c5f OP_EQUALVERIFY OP_CHECKSIG
address
LN9L79kSajCaxyanr45RH7vCrYqSVQFSaX
transaction
e3831d13e70cfbb14da69027655e3787d67d53b87566a58460b7ea6704458afa
spent
true